I just purchased One Of These.
When it is plugged in my system won't post.
I can hear a click inside my psu and the system immediately powers off.

Removing the splitter results in the system working fine.
"Includes two 2200?F capacitors for stabilizing +12V and +5V voltages"

Are those two caps potentially drawing enough power to overload the psu ?
I'm using a 400watt seasonic X series in a llano system with 4 hard drives.
